External independent assessment discussed in Aqmescit

Education - 03 January 2012, Tuesday 16:47
  External independent assessment discussed in Aqmescit AQMESCIT/ SIMFEROPIL (QHA) - The Ministry of Education and Science, Youth and Sports of Crimea has held a republican seminar for chiefs of city and raion education departments and specialists supervising the organization of external independent assessment of knowledge (EIA). QHA learnt this from the Main Information Policy Department of the Crimean Council of Ministers.
The meeting analyzed the EIA of 2011, its shortcomings, as well as organization and registration of EIA 2012 participants.
At the workshop it was noted that the 2011 EIA involved more than 8,000 people. In 2012, the number of school leavers is expected to increase three times, which will entail rising of testing centres and staff involved in the procedure.
According to the Minister of Education and Science, Youth and Sports of Crimea, Vitalina Dzoz, the main peculiarity of this year’s EIA will be the reduction of registration time for EIA 2012 participants – from January 1 to February 20, 2012.
In addition, the school year will end earlier this year.
The minister recalled that to implement education programmes, teachers are recommended to amend curriculums, including extra lessons and consultations in them.
